Planting Position

Our summer fruit range is excellent for small informal gardens and containers. They will do well in sheltered areas, full sun to partial shade, and moist but well-drained soils.

 

After Care

This Summer fruit range is easy to grow but does require some maintenance. Prune any dried, overlapping or damaged branches twice yearly to maintain a healthy plant and encourage fruit production.

 

Size

Summer fruit bushes can reach a height of up to 1-2m with a 2-2.5m spread, depending on the variety.
